11. Persevere in Problem Solving Emma and Tony are playing a game. Each draws a triangle
on a coordinate grid. For each turn, Emma chooses either the horizontal or vertical value for
a vector in component form. Tony chooses the other value, alternating each turn. They each
have to draw a new image of their triangle using the vector with the components they chose
and using the image from the prior turn as the preimage. Whoever has drawn an image in
each of the four quadrants first wins the game.
Emma's initial triangle has the coordinates (3, 0), (-4, —2), (-2, -2) and Tony's initial
triangle has the coordinates (2, 4), (2, 2), (4, 3). On the first turn the vector (6, –5) is used
and on the second turn the vector (-10, 8) is used. What quadrant does Emma need to
translate her triangle to in order to win? What quadrant does Tony need to translate his
triangle to in order to win? Emma needs to translaté

Transformations in the coordinate plane maps preimage coordinate points to the coordinate points of the image

  • The quadrant Emma needs to translate her triangle to in order to win are; 3rd and 1st quadrants
  • The quadrant Tony needs to translate his image to in order to win is; 3rd quadrant

The reason the above values are correct are as follows:

The given parameter are;

The coordinates of Emma's initial triangle are; (3, 0), (-4, -2), (-2, -2)

Tony's initial triangle coordinates are; (2, 4), (2, 2), (4, 3)

The vector used on the first turn is <6, -5>, which gives;

Emma's first transformation, [tex]T_{(6, \ -5)}[/tex]

1st quadrant (3, 0) → 4th quadrant (9, -5)

3rd quadrant (-4, -2) → 4th quadrant (2, -7)

3rd quadrant (-2, -2) → 4th quadrant (4, -5)

Tony's first transformation, [tex]T_{(6, \ -5)}[/tex]

1st quadrant (2, 4) → 4th quadrant (8, -1)

1st quadrant (2, 2) → 4th quadrant (8, -3)

1st quadrant (4, 3) → 4th quadrant (10, -2)

Emma's second transformation, [tex]T_{(-10, \ 8)}[/tex]

4th quadrant (9, -5) → 2nd quadrant (-1, 3)

4th quadrant (2, -7) → 2nd quadrant (-8, 1)

4th quadrant (4, -5) → 2nd quadrant (-6, 3)

Tony's second transformation, [tex]T_{(-10, \ 8)}[/tex]

4th quadrant (8, -1) → 2nd quadrant (-2, 7)

4th quadrant (8, -3) → 2nd quadrant (-2, 5)

4th quadrant (10, -2) → 1st quadrant (0, 6)

From the above translation transformations, Emma has drawn an image in the 4th and 2nd quadrant, and would needs to draw an image in the 3rd and 1st quadrant

Similarly, from the above values, Tony has drawn an image in the 4th quadrant, 2nd quadrant and 1st quadrant, therefore Tony needs to translate to only the 3rd quadrant in order to win
